Raising kids and caring for an aging loved one?
You don't have to be the only one keeping all the plates spinning.
As the kids head back to school, look for ways to share some of the responsibility:
🍂 Need someone to check in? The Canadian Red Cross offers free Friendly Calls for regular social connection.
🍂 Need help finding local resources? Call 211 and ask about supports available for seniors and caregivers.
🍂 Looking for connection and activities? WE Seniors Edmonton is a wonderful community resource offering programs, social opportunities, wellness activities and support for older adults.
🍂 Feeling overwhelmed? Make a list of everything you're doing; appointments, groceries, meals, errands, check-ins, and see what can be shared, simplified or supported.
You don't have to do everything yourself to be there for someone you love.
